<h2><span data-preserver-spaces="true">What is the BAC level in Utah?</span></h2>
<p><span data-preserver-spaces="true">The permissible blood alcohol web content (BAC) degree while driving a lorry in Utah is.05 percent. As you may have heard in the news, this makes Utah the state with the lowest legal driving limit. Drivers with industrial driving licenses (CDL) are heavily managed in Utah, as they cannot surpass a BAC limit.04 percent. Additionally, drivers under the age of 21, driving with a BAC over absolutely no percent, is against the legislation.</span></p>

<h4><span data-preserver-spaces="true">What are the charges for a DUI in Utah?</span></h4>
<p><span data-preserver-spaces="true">As is the case with any new wrongdoer, they will generally get a lower punishment than a repeat offender. When you are convicted of drunk driving the first time in Utah, you will undoubtedly encounter a minimum of 2 days behind bars. Addedly, you will receive a fine of at least $1,400 as well as be suspended from driving for 120 days. (If you refused a breath, blood, or urine examination, your certificate will be revoked for 18 months on a very first DUI.) Sometimes, a court will allow community service to replace prison time (as well as sometimes even credit rating penalties) or even reach allowing a residence or work digital release ankle joint surveillance program. Also, you will certainly more than likely be required to participate in a medicine or alcohol evaluation/screening, which may suggest therapy to establish if you have a chemical abuse issue.</span></p>
<p><span data-preserver-spaces="true">For each extra DUI sentence within ten years, the administrative license assents and criminal fines enhance. Suppose you are founded guilty a second time of a DUI in Utah within ten years of the initial conviction. In that case, there will be a greater minimal fine, a suggested prison sentence of a minimum of 240 hrs (or ten days) as set by law, a need to use a pricey ignition interlock gadget (mini-, portable breath analyzer test) to start your car, costly monitored probation, etc. And, instead of a 120 day put on hold certificate, your license will be suspended for at the very least two years (or 36 months for a refusal).</span></p>
<p><span data-preserver-spaces="true">For a 3rd DUI in one decade, you will certainly be facing a </span><a class="editor-rtfLink" href="https://criminal.awebdevz.com/the-consequences-of-a-felony-conviction-in-utah/"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er"><span data-preserver-spaces="true">3rd level Felony</span></a><span data-preserver-spaces="true"> cost, a minimum of 1,500 hours (or 62.5 days) behind bars, and so on. 										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><span data-preserver-spaces="true">Utah is in an exciting place. We are a generally conservative state, with a strong religious presence. Like Colorado, California, and Nevada, our surrounding neighbors seem to have a different way of life. All three of these states have enormously changed their marijuana laws, allowing for recreational use. Marijuana is a Schedule 1 controlled substance and is illegal to possess, baring a legitimate medical reason. The amount in possession determines the punishments and charges associated with drugs.</span></p>

<p><span data-preserver-spaces="true">It does come down to the amount of marijuana the person has in their possession during the arrest.</span></p>
<ul>
<li><strong><span data-preserver-spaces="true">One ounce or less</span></strong><span data-preserver-spaces="true"> – class B misdemeanor</span>
<ul>
<li class="ql-indent-1"><span data-preserver-spaces="true">Up to six months of jail time</span></li>
<li class="ql-indent-1"><span data-preserver-spaces="true">Up to $1,940 in fines and an assessment</span></li>
<li class="ql-indent-1"><span data-preserver-spaces="true">Possession in a drug-free zone such as a school, church, or park can result in a charge being upgraded to a class A misdemeanor</span></li>
</ul>
</li>
<li><strong><span data-preserver-spaces="true">Between one ounce and one pound</span></strong><span data-preserver-spaces="true"> – class A misdemeanor</span>
<ul>
<li class="ql-indent-1"><span data-preserver-spaces="true">Up to 12 months of jail time</span></li>
<li class="ql-indent-1"><span data-preserver-spaces="true">Up to $4,790 in fines and an assessment</span></li>
</ul>
</li>
<li><strong><span data-preserver-spaces="true">Between one and 100 pounds</span></strong><span data-preserver-spaces="true"> – a third-degree felony</span>
<ul>
<li class="ql-indent-1"><span data-preserver-spaces="true">Up to five years in Utah State Prison</span></li>
<li class="ql-indent-1"><span data-preserver-spaces="true">Up to $9,540 in fines</span></li>
</ul>
</li>
<li><strong><span data-preserver-spaces="true">Over 100 pounds</span></strong><span data-preserver-spaces="true"> – a second-degree felony</span>
<ul>
<li class="ql-indent-1"><span data-preserver-spaces="true">Up to 15 years in Utah State Prison</span></li>
<li class="ql-indent-1"><span data-preserver-spaces="true">Up to $19,040 in fines and an assessment</span></li>
</ul>
</li>
</ul>
